Military Aviation Digest — Week 24, 2026

Week 24, 2026 · 8 Jun – 14 Jun 2026

Between 8 June and 14 June 2026, 4 military aviation events were recorded worldwide, including 4 aircraft lost or retired, spanning 3 countries and 4 aircraft types. United States was the most active air force this week with 2 events.
